Earlier this week, the Wisconsin LGBT Chamber of Commerce brought together a diverse group of business leaders to discuss how equality plays out in the workplace.
That’s an issue the Human Rights Campaign has worked on for a long time. One of the leaders of that effort is Deena Fidas, who heads the HRC’s Workplace Equality Program and directs its yearly Corporate Equality Index survey.
She joined Lake Effect's Mitch Teich to talk about the program's latest efforts in the ever-changing political and social climates.
"You're seeing all corners of the corporate world really defining LGBT equality as both best for the communities in which they operate, and also good for their own bottom line in terms of their work forces," Fidas said.
